/* CSS Document */
/* written by Mint Marketing for PeopleService Inc. */

body, html {
		margin:0; padding:0;
		background-color: #000000;
		font: normal 12px Tahoma, Trebuchet, Arial, Helvetica, sans-serif;
		
		}
		#spacer {position: absolute; float: left; border: 0; z-index: 10;}
		#spacer a:link {border: 0;}
		#spacer a:hover {border: 0;}
		#spacer a:visited {border: 0;}
		#spacer a href {border:0;}
a:link {
	color: #50b848;
	text-decoration:none;
	}
	a:hover {
		text-decoration:underline;
		color: #3366cc;
		}
		a:visited {
		text-decoration:underline;
		color: #b4d670;
		}
	
	#header {
		margin:0; padding:0 0 9px 0;
		color: #ffffff;
		background:url("images/leaf.jpg") top right no-repeat;
		height: 105px;
		}
	#container {width:800px;
	margin-left:auto;
	margin-right:auto;
	
	
	}

	#leftcolumn {
		float:left;
		width:165px;
		margin:0; padding:0px;

	
		}
	.dotted {display:block; border-bottom: 1px dotted #000000; height: 12px;}
	
	#rightcolumn {
		float:right;
		width:105px;
		margin-top:23px; padding:0px;
		background-color:#000000;
		height: auto;
		color: #FFFFFF;
		
		}
	#maincolumn {
		margin:0 165px;
	
		padding: 0;
		border-left: 10px solid #000000;

		}
	.cleaner {
		clear:both;
		height:1px;
		font-size:1px;
		border:none;
		margin:0; padding:0;
		background:transparent;
		
		}
	#main1 {
		margin:0; padding:0;
		background-color: #ffffff;
		background-image:url("images/blackback.jpg");
		background-position:top right;
		background-repeat:repeat-y;
		}
	#main3 {
		margin:0; padding:0;
	
		background:url("images/waterdroplet.jpg") bottom left no-repeat;
		}
		#main2 {
		background-image: url("images/leftback.jpg");
		background-position: 165px;
		background-repeat:repeat-y;
		}
		#main4 {
				background:url("images/topright.jpg") top repeat-x;
}
	#footer {
		margin:0px;
		padding:10px;
		width: 800px;
		COLOR:#000000;
	}
	#acrobat {
		float:left;
		background-color:#000000;
		color: #ffffff;
		width: 150px;
		font-size: 8px;
	}
	#acrobat img {padding:5px;
	}
	#textlinks {
		float:left;
		padding-left:38px;
		background-color:#000000;
		color: #FFFFFF;
		width: auto;
		font-size: 10px;
		text-align:center;
}
	
.ddm1 {
    font: 11px tahoma;
}
.ddm1 .item1,
.ddm1 .item1:hover,
.ddm1 .item1-active,
.ddm1 .item1-active:hover {
    padding: 3px 8px 4px 8px;
    border: 1px #003366;
    border-style: solid none solid none;
    text-decoration: none;
    display: block;
    position: relative;
}
.ddm1 .item1 {
    background: #0EA138;
    color: #ffffff;
	text-decoration: none;
}
.ddm1 .item1:hover,
.ddm1 .item1-active,
.ddm1 .item1-active:hover {
    background: #b4d670;
    color: #000000;
}
.ddm1 .item2,
.ddm1 .item2:hover {
    padding: 3px 8px 4px 8px;
    text-decoration: none;
    display: block;
    white-space: nowrap;
}
.ddm1 .item2 {
    background: #3264C7;
    color: #ffffff;
}
.ddm1 .item2:hover {
    background: #6699FF;
    color: #ffffff;
}
.ddm1 .section {
    border: 1px #003366;
    border-style: solid solid solid solid;
    position: absolute;
    visibility: hidden;
    z-index: -1;
    white-space: nowrap;
}
.ddm1 .left, .ddm1 .left:hover { border-style: solid none solid solid; }
.ddm1 .right, .ddm1 .right:hover { border-style: solid solid solid none; }

* html .ddm1 td { position: relative; } /* ie 5.0 fix */
	.clear {clear:both;
	}
	.greenpix {
		border: solid 1px #33cc33;
		padding: 10px;
		margin-left: 3px;
	}
	.mainnpix {
		border: solid 1px #33cc33;
		padding: 10px;
		margin: 10px;
	}
	.lefttext {
		padding:2px;
	}
	.logo {
		background: url("images/logo.jpg") 0px 20px no-repeat;
		height: 105px;
	}
	.contact { 
		padding-left: 360px;
		padding-top: 10px;
		padding-bottom: 5px;
	}

	
	.maintext {
	padding: 20px 0px 20px 20px;
	/* Hide from IE-Mac \*/
	padding: 0px 0px 20px 20px;
	/* End hide */
	margin-top: 10px;
	}
	h1 {
	color:#50b848;
	font-size: 20px;
	font-stretch:expanded;
	
	}
	h2 {
	font-size: 14px;
	font-weight:200;
	text-transform: uppercase;
	}
	h3 {
	font-size: 12px;
	font-weight: bold;
	line-height: 16px;
	}
	h4 {color:#3366cc;
	font-size: 14px;
	font-weight: bold;
	text-transform: uppercase;}
	
	li {list-style:url("images/bullet.jpg");
	line-height: 20px;
	} 
	#leftcolumn li {
	margin-left:-10px;
	font-size: 10px;
	list-style:url("images/bullet2.jpg");
	line-height: 14px;}
	.style1 {color: #3366cc;
	font-size: 18px;}
	em {color: #666666;}
	.blue h2 {color: #3366cc;}
.style2 {font-size: 20px}
.input {
font-weight: bold;
text-transform: uppercase;
font-family:"Courier New", Courier, mono;
font-stretch:expanded;
border-top: 0px;
border-bottom: #3366cc solid 2px;
border-left: #50b848 dotted 1px;
padding: 5px;
background-color: #FFFFCC;

}
.lighttext {color: #666666;}
	.style3 {color: #3366cc;
	font-size: 13px;}
	#application {
	}
	#application h2 {display:block;
	padding: 3px;
	background-color:#000000;
	color: #ffffff;}
	.app {background-color:#CCCCCC }
	
	.box {border: 1px solid #000; padding: 15px;}
	.clear {clear: both;}